Industry Overview in Finland
Finland is rapidly increasing its renewable energy capacity, with wind power playing a pivotal role in shaping the country's sustainable energy future. Currently, over 90% of Finland's electricity is derived from low-emission sources, with nearly a quarter coming from wind energy. The nation's ambition of achieving climate neutrality by 2035 presents an attractive market for wind energy, though it also introduces regulatory challenges and limitations on grid capacity.
However, the growth of new wind farms faces significant obstacles. The absence of direct government subsidies complicates development efforts, leading to a reliance on Power Purchase Agreements (PPAs) to ensure project viability. Furthermore, land use regulations, especially those concerning military buffer zones adjacent to Russia, add complexity, as all new wind projects must first receive authorization from Finnish defense authorities.
Additionally, strict biodiversity guidelines, particularly regarding raptors, remain a critical consideration; wind turbines must be positioned at least two kilometers away from eagle nests, constraining site selection. Environmental assessments and monitoring technologies, such as bird radar systems capable of halting turbine operations temporarily, further complicate project implementation.
Despite these challenges, Axpo has swiftly advanced its Lålax project, having already secured all necessary permits, which is typically a prolonged process spanning three years. The Rationale Behind the Deal
The acquisition of the Lålax wind farm, comprising four turbines with a combined capacity of 24.8 MW and expected to generate approximately 70 GWh of renewable electricity annually, reflects Axpo's strategic commitment to enhancing its renewable energy portfolio. Joakim Ingves, Head of Wind Activities for Axpo in Finland, emphasized the project's significance in demonstrating sustainable growth and development within the Finnish energy sector.
